It's December, which to us means holiday lights, tinsel and the first trickle of CES news. Come January, you'll be able to buy this Jeep-branded, rubber-encased, mud-treaded Jeep GPS RT 300. It sports a 3.5" LCD touch-screen, built-in MP3 and video player, and, just to make driving that much more difficult, an eBook reader. We'll try and find out where this piece of hardware's actual guts come from at CES, since we're pretty sure Jeep hasn't begun manufacturing consumer electronics under our noses.
Expect to pay about $399 at the first of next year, about the same time we'll be bringing you live coverage of CES, the world's largest collection of electronics, geeks and ear-bursting subwoofers.
